What can I expect from the breakfast at Beachrunners Inn?
The breakfast at Beachrunners Inn is described as very satisfying, fresh, and varied. It includes a fresh fruit dish daily and a hot main course daily. The host is available to answer all questions a guest may have for sights to visit and recommendations for dining.
What are the common concerns about the beds at Beachrunners Inn?
Some guests have mentioned that the beds at Beachrunners Inn were uncomfortable, seemed very old, and dipped in the middle. However, others found the beds very comfortable.
What are the parking options at Beachrunners Inn?
Beachrunners Inn offers free parking, although some guests have mentioned that it is on-street parking and could be a bit limited.
How is the cleanliness at Beachrunners Inn?
Guests have described Beachrunners Inn as a meticulously clean and charming home. However, some have mentioned specific issues such as a constant drip in the bathroom and outdated outlets for electronics.
